Transaction 44a1a1818c5fbc1086fdf0559528a45cdb5dc30d646ef5b77b786dca9684cf25
1 Input
1 Output
-
44a1a1818c5fbc1086fdf0559528a45cdb5dc30d646ef5b77b786dca9684cf25:0
- value
- 16850813
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8c0008b9f6edb4dff30565e53c27751ab139071
- address
- bc1qarqqpzuldmd5mles2e098snh2x438yr370jxud